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ton is to bus and line 35 bus which costs $14 - $23 and takes 6h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ton is to drive which takes 1h 58m and costs $18 - $27.
No, there is no direct bus from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ton. However, there are services departing from Hood River and arriving at Silverton Hospital - Center @ Fairview via Portland Curbside Bus Stop and Downtown Transit Center - Bay V.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 22m.
The distance between Hood River and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ton is 130 miles. The road distance is 99.6 miles.
The best way to get from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ton without a car is to bus and train which takes 3h 45m and costs $65 - $110.
It takes approximately 3h 45m to get from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ton, including transfers.
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ton bus services, operated by Flixbus USA, depart from Hood River station.
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ton bus services, operated by Flixbus USA, arrive at Portland Curbside Bus Stop station.
Yes, the driving distance between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ton is 100 miles. It takes approximately 1h 58m to drive from Hood River to Oregon Garden Resort, Silverton.
